    Garden Centre, or Nursery is what we call it in the uk lol... great vid. With the vegtable garden try putting as much organic matter as you can on it, bark chip is really good, it wont happen straight away but it will make heavy clay soil a lot lighter and compost like. A small compost heap to put all those fallen leaves in and once it's rotted down would be great for the veg patch too.
